[quote=Anonymous]13:43 PP here, great info, thanks. A few colleges offer programs mostly online, but practicum-type experiences are still required so programs can't be done 100% online. Hopefully OP can find something that fits her needs. Most graduate-type programs are really flexible with scheduling and so forth for people who are working/have a family while pursuing their degree. Some schools offer intensive classes in the summer (in person and online) and night classes. My graduate degree has taken about 2 years, with taking classes in the Fall, Spring, and Summer.[/quote]
